diff options
author | Max Harmathy | 2022-01-05 13:56:31 +0100 |
---|---|---|
committer | Max Harmathy | 2022-01-05 13:56:31 +0100 |
commit | 4f47bbef48ccc8690f6b09230920d5423031e44c (patch) | |
tree | cdb9fbb5a2366c54fc95ff6f1819583dfd255e77 | |
parent | b916108b9b19cead4ff5cd071f6c271536b437a2 (diff) | |
download | aur-4f47bbef48ccc8690f6b09230920d5423031e44c.tar.gz |
Update to v1.5
-rw-r--r-- | .SRCINFO | 7 | ||||
-rw-r--r-- | PKGBUILD | 16 |
2 files changed, 12 insertions, 11 deletions
@@ -1,15 +1,16 @@ pkgbase = ptouch-print pkgdesc = Command line tool to print labels on Brother P-Touch printers - pkgver = 1.4.3 - pkgrel = 2 + pkgver = 1.5 + pkgrel = 1 url = https://familie-radermacher.ch/dominic/projekte/ptouch-print/ arch = x86_64 license = GPL3 makedepends = git + makedepends = cmake depends = gd depends = libusb provides = ptouch-print - source = git+https://familie-radermacher.ch/cgi/cgit/linux/ptouch-print.git#commit=32c0d3be29f9eebb5d0e48f4f998da83b0c2ff3c + source = git+https://familie-radermacher.ch/cgi/cgit/linux/ptouch-print.git#tag=v1.5 sha256sums = SKIP pkgname = ptouch-print @@ -2,28 +2,28 @@ # Contributor: Caltlgin Stsodaat <contact@fossdaily.xyz> pkgname='ptouch-print' -pkgver=1.4.3 -pkgrel=2 +pkgver=1.5 +pkgrel=1 pkgdesc="Command line tool to print labels on Brother P-Touch printers" arch=('x86_64') url='https://familie-radermacher.ch/dominic/projekte/ptouch-print/' license=('GPL3') depends=('gd' 'libusb') -makedepends=('git') +makedepends=('git' 'cmake') provides=("${pkgname}") -source=("git+https://familie-radermacher.ch/cgi/cgit/linux/${pkgname}.git#commit=32c0d3be29f9eebb5d0e48f4f998da83b0c2ff3c") +source=("git+https://familie-radermacher.ch/cgi/cgit/linux/${pkgname}.git#tag=v${pkgver}") # NB: updpkgsums --> SKIP sha256sums=('SKIP') build() { cd "${pkgname}" - autoreconf --install - ./configure --prefix=/usr - make + mkdir -p build + cmake -B build -D CMAKE_BUILD_TYPE=Release + make -C build } package() { - make DESTDIR="${pkgdir}" -C "${pkgname}" install + install -Dm755 -t "${pkgdir}/usr/bin/${pkgname}" "${pkgname}/build/ptouch-print" install -Dm644 -t "${pkgdir}/usr/share/man/man1" "${pkgname}/${pkgname}.1" install -Dm644 -t "${pkgdir}/usr/share/doc/${pkgname}" "${pkgname}/README" } |